THE NEGEV – ISRAEL’S FLOURISHING DESERT
Air Force Museum in Be’er Sheva — Learn about the thrilling history of Israel’s legendary Air Force. View actual fighter aircraft and aerospace displays. Audio-visual presentations include the Independence War of 1948, Israel Air Force commander heroes, and the evolution of the IAF over the generations.
Ben Gurion’s Home — Get an insider's look at how the first Prime Minister of Israel lived after retirement with a visit to his preserved home at Sde Boker. This hut is a monument to the first leader of Israel, his life as a politician and kibbutznik, and his extraordinary belief in Israel's Negev region.
Camel Rides and Bedouin Village Experience — Next, we’ll stop for camel rides & refreshments at a Bedouin settlement in the Negev!
Mitzpeh Ramon Crater — Enjoy spectacular views of the desert and witness this unique geological phenomenon. Israel’s largest national park, the crater is located at the peak of Mount Negev. At first sight, the crater appears as if it was formed by a meteor impact but in truth is a natural formation.
